大数据规律预测是指利用历史数据和现代数据分析技术,对未知的未来趋势进行预测。这种预测方法的核心在于通过收集、处理和分析大量数据来发现潜在的模式和关联,从而对未来的发展趋势做出合理的推断。
一、数据驱动的预测流程
1. 数据收集: 这是任何预测过程的基础。需要收集与目标事件相关的所有相关数据,包括时间序列数据、问卷调查数据、传感器数据等。例如,对于股票市场的预测,可能需要收集历史股价数据、交易量数据、宏观经济指标数据等。
2. 数据处理: 收集到的数据往往需要清洗和预处理,以去除错误和异常值,确保数据的质量和一致性。这可能包括缺失值填补、异常值检测和处理、数据归一化或标准化等操作。
3. 特征工程: 在处理完数据之后,接下来是构建模型所需的特征。这通常涉及从原始数据中提取有意义的信息,将其转换为可以用于机器学习算法输入的形式。例如,根据股票价格的历史数据,可以提取移动平均线、相对强弱指数等作为特征。
4. 模型选择与训练: 根据问题的性质和可用数据的特点,选择合适的预测模型。常见的有线性回归、决策树、随机森林、支持向量机等。通过训练数据集来训练这些模型,并调整模型参数以获得最佳性能。
5. 模型评估与优化: 使用独立的测试集来评估模型的性能。常用的评估指标包括准确率、召回率、f1分数等。根据评估结果,可能需要调整模型结构、参数或数据预处理步骤。
6. 预测与验证: 使用训练好的模型对新数据进行预测,并对预测结果进行验证。验证可以通过交叉验证、留出法等方式进行。
二、未来趋势预测的实例
假设我们要预测未来的股市走势。首先,我们会收集过去几年的股市数据,如每日收盘价、成交量、宏观经济指标等。然后,通过数据清洗和预处理,将数据转换为适合机器学习算法的格式。接着,我们可能会使用诸如移动平均线、相对强弱指数等特征来构建模型。最后,通过模型训练和评估,我们可以预测未来的股市走势,并据此为投资决策提供参考。
三、挑战与展望
大数据规律预测虽然具有广泛的应用前景,但也面临诸多挑战。例如,如何有效处理大规模数据、如何保证数据质量、如何设计有效的模型等。随着技术的发展,如深度学习、强化学习等新兴技术的应用,大数据规律预测的准确性和效率将得到进一步提升。
总的来说,大数据规律预测是一种基于数据驱动的方法,通过分析历史数据来预测未来趋势。尽管存在一些挑战,但随着技术的不断发展,这一领域的应用前景仍然非常广阔。